Leaves of absence for public health workers suspended due to rising COVID-19 cases

By 3 years ago

The government is suspending holidays or leaves of absence for public healthcare workers as of September 1 due to the rising number of COVID-19 cases.

Included in the order are all staff in the National Health System hospitals, the emergency ambulance service, the National Public Health Organisation, and Primary Health Care centres.

COVID-19 incidents are expected to rise during the first two weeks of September when holidaymakers return to cities, social activities resume, and schools reopen.
